Founded in 1945 by Dr. Carl Sharsmith, the herbarium at San Jose State University houses a collection of more than 18,500 dried plant specimens. Many specimens were collected over Dr. Sharsmith's long career as a university professor and natural history ranger at Yosemite National Park. The collection is actively curated with approximately 500 new specimens being added every year.

Collection Statistics
  • 9,886 (60%) georeferenced
  • 14,564 (89%) with media (14,584 total media)
  • 16,254 (99%) specimen records
  • 254 Families
  • 1,591 Genera
  • 5,250 Species
  • 6,100 total taxa (including subsp. and var.)
